A healthy body, among others, characterized by the body's ability to maintain ideal body weight. Ideal body weight is the weight that matched the height according to certain formulas and the results were adjusted to a predetermined standard.

In adults, known as body mass index formula, namely body weight (BW) divided by height (meters) squared. While infants and toddlers can be measured by weigh, and then recorded in the Card Towards Healthy (CTH). Healthy children, growing old, gaining weight.

"The child was one year old and over, each year will increase 2.5 kg weight until they are 18 years old. Parents should be suspicious if two consecutive months of her son BW does not increase," said Dr.Idrus Jus'at, dean of the Faculty of Health Sciences , Esa Unggul University, Jakarta.

In adults, body mass index (BMI) of normal is 18.5 to 24.9. BMI value of 25 considered overweight and 27 to the top classified as overweight and obesity. Although widely used, but the BMI can not be a measuring tool for weight children and bodybuilders who have a lot of muscle.

You need to be wary if the BMI reaches 27. People who are overweight are more susceptible to various diseases.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, there are some diseases associated with high BMI values​​, such as coronary heart disease, type 2 diabetes, cancer, high blood pressure, dyslipidemia (high cholesterol), stroke, sleep apnea, osteoarthritis, and so on.
